Overview

The Keysight 87206B is an SP6T terminated multiport coaxial switch designed for high-frequency automated test and measurement, signal monitoring, and routing applications up to 20 GHz. The six-port configuration provides multi-channel switching flexibility while delivering 10 million cycle operating life with exceptional 0.03 dB insertion loss repeatability guaranteed for 5 million cycles. This model is well-suited for production test systems and RF measurement instrumentation requiring reliable multi-port switching at microwave frequencies.

Key Features

  • SP6T configuration with six independent switch ports
  • Frequency range dc to 20 GHz
  • 10 million cycle operating life with magnetic latching
  • 0.03 dB insertion loss repeatability guaranteed to 5 million cycles
  • Excellent isolation across frequency range
  • Terminated ports for optimized signal path
  • Self-interrupting drive circuit
  • Compatible with Keysight 87130A/70611A and 11713B/C attenuator/switch drivers

Applications

  • Production test systems for RF and microwave components
  • Multi-channel signal routing in measurement instrumentation
  • Automated test equipment for microwave subsystems
  • Satellite and antenna monitoring systems
